Leo Executive Suite, Self Check-In, Free Garage, FAST Wi-Fi, Concierge - B&BLeo Executive Suite, Self Check-In, Free Garage, FAST Wi-Fi, Concierge - B&B

Leo Executive Suite, Self Check-In, Free Garage, FAST Wi-Fi, Concierge

guest room for your stay

Deluxe StudioDeluxe Studio

Deluxe Studio

Studio
  • 1 bedroom & 1 bathroom
  • 33 m²
  • Private bathroom
  • Air conditioning
  • Private kitchen
  • Garden view
  • Private entrance
  • Bath